### Checklist Item 14: Calendar Sync Conflict Resolution

Verify that the Plannerly sync engine resolves double-booked events deterministically when both the local and remote copies were edited within the same five-minute window. Confirm the reviewer has exercised the tie-break path with mocked clock skew, and that the conflict log records which copy won and why. Any deviation from the documented last-writer-wins exception list must be flagged. Escalations on this item route to the owner named below.

named custodian: Oliath Ralax

Paritywatch compares nightly rate snapshots across our booking channels for each hotel property and flags mismatches over the configured threshold. Support tickets about "stale parity alerts" usually mean the snapshot job lagged; check the job status page first. If a customer disputes a flagged rate, pull the raw snapshot rows rather than the dashboard summary, since the dashboard caches hourly. Query the snapshot database directly using the connection string below.

primary connection of yagep-kahip = redis://giliel_svc:zYiKsLL2PLpfPL@db-348f.xolmarsys.corp:5432/fenwyn

# Heads up: the humidity sensors in the Vernleaf greenhouse rigs drift
# noticeably after about two weeks of continuous duty. We compensate in
# software rather than recalibrating hardware every time, since the
# Pellowick units are sealed. If plants look fine but readings seem off,
# it's almost always drift, not a real change. Don't tweak these without
# logging a note first. The current drift-compensation constants are as
# follows.

tuning table, kajog-bawip:
TIERS = {
    "kelius": 256,
    "lammir": 543,
}